引言
随着区块链技术的快速发展,加密货币的使用变得越来越普及。以太坊(Ethereum)作为第二大市值的加密货币平台,广泛应用于智能合约和去中心化应用(DApps)的开发。以太坊轻钱包作为管理以太坊及其代币的一种便利工具,正在成为区块链商业环境中的一项重要产品。本篇文章将深入探讨以太坊轻钱包的开发商业模型,包括市场需求、技术要求、竞争分析及成功案例。
1. 以太坊轻钱包的概述
以太坊轻钱包是一种与以太坊网络交互的应用程序,允许用户安全地存储、发送和接收以太币(ETH)以及ERC-20标准的代币。与全节点钱包不同,轻钱包通过连接到以太坊网络的远程节点来实现数据的同步,降低了对存储和计算资源的需求,使得其在移动设备和资源受限的环境下,依然能够高效运作。
2. 市场需求分析
近年来,随着比特币和以太坊的流行,用户对数字资产的管理需求不断增加。尤其是轻钱包的便利性,使得其成为新手用户和移动用户的首选工具。根据市场研究,预计数字钱包市场将持续增长,考虑到以下几个因素:
- 区块链技术的普及给用户带来便利,让更多人愿意尝试数字资产投资。
- 对于安全性、易用性和功能性等方面的需求,使得轻钱包成为重要产品。
- 去中心化金融(DeFi)和非同质化代币(NFT)的兴起,进一步推动了用户对数字钱包的需求。
3. 开发以太坊轻钱包的技术要求
为了开发一个成功的以太坊轻钱包,需考虑技术架构、用户体验、安全性等多个维度:
- 技术架构:使用现有的以太坊客户端如Geth、Parity等进行通信,并利用Web3.js等库来与以太坊网络进行交互。
- 用户体验:应设计简单明了的用户界面以及流畅的用户操作流程,以提高用户留存率。
- 安全性:轻钱包需要结合多重签名、私钥加密、恢复种子短语等安全机制,以确保用户资产的安全。
4. 竞争分析
目前市场上已经存在多个以太坊轻钱包产品,例如MetaMask、Trust Wallet以及Exodus等。这些产品各具特色,竞争较为激烈。在开发过程中,必须明确自己产品的独特优势,比如:
- 提供更好的用户体验或个性化定制服务。
- 集成更多的DeFi功能,吸引需要进行流动性提供或借贷的用户群体。
- 安全保障手段,提升用户对钱包安全性的信任。
5. 成功案例分析
在以太坊轻钱包的成功案例中,MetaMask凭借其广泛的用户基础和强大的功能,成为市场领导者。MetaMask的发展历程中注重用户反馈,持续产品体验,并通过与DeFi项目的合作,增加了其在用户心中的价值。这一成功案例为新兴钱包开发者提供了重要的借鉴。
问题与解答
以太坊轻钱包的主要功能是什么?
以太坊轻钱包的主要功能包括:
- 资产管理:允许用户查看和管理其以太币及ERC-20代币。
- 交易功能:支持发送和接收以太币,方便用户进行交易。
- 与DApps的连接:无缝连接以太坊上各种去中心化应用,提升用户体验。
- 安全性功能:实现相应的安全措施以保护用户的私钥和资金安全。
以上功能是以太坊轻钱包的核心,用户在选择和使用钱包时会关注这些功能的实现程度。
开发以太坊轻钱包需要哪些技术栈?
开发以太坊轻钱包所需的技术栈通常包括:
- 前端开发框架:例如React或者Vue.js,用于构建用户界面。
- 后端服务:Node.js作为后端语言,并配合Express.js等框架进行业务逻辑的处理。
- 区块链交互库:使用Web3.js或以太坊提供的其他SDK来与以太坊区块链进行交互。
- 数据库技术:例如MongoDB或PostgreSQL,用于管理用户数据和钱包信息。
掌握这些技术能够有效提升以太坊轻钱包的开发效率与质量。
如何确保以太坊轻钱包的安全性?
确保以太坊轻钱包的安全性是一个复杂且重要的问题。以下是一些有效的方法:
- 私钥存储:私钥不应存储在服务器上,可以使用加密算法将私钥存储在用户端的安全环境中。
- 用户身份验证:使用多因素认证(MFA)来增强用户登录时的安全性。
- 交易签名:每笔交易均需用户手动确认和签名,避免无意间发送资金。
- 定期安全审计:对钱包应用定期进行安全审计,及时修复漏洞。
以上措施将有助于提升以太坊轻钱包的安全水平,增进用户信任。
用户在使用以太坊轻钱包时需要注意哪些事项?
在使用以太坊轻钱包的过程中,用户应关注以下几点:
- 备份私钥和种子短语:在钱包创建后,务必妥善备份私钥和种子短语,以防止遗失。
- 警惕网络钓鱼:注意识别真伪网站,避免输入私钥或种子短语在可疑网站上。
- 更新应用程序:定期检查并更新钱包应用至最新版本,以便获得最新的安全保护和功能。
- 监控交易活动:定期检查钱包内的资产和交易记录,及时发现异常活动。
通过关注这些注意事项,用户可以有效保障自己在使用轻钱包过程中的安全性。
轻钱包与全节点钱包的区别?
轻钱包与全节点钱包在功能和使用上存在显著差异:
- 存储要求:全节点钱包需要下载整个区块链数据,占用大量存储空间,而轻钱包仅需存储必要的资料,大幅降低了存储要求。
- 同步速度:轻钱包通过远程节点进行数据同步,速度更快,而全节点需自行验证区块数据,耗时较长。
- 安全性与隐私:全节点钱包通过本地验证增强了用户的安全性,但轻钱包则可能在隐私上面临风险;不过,轻钱包的安全性可以通过采取额外的保护措施得到提升。
理解这些差异,用户可以根据自身需求选择最合适的数字钱包形式。
结论
以太坊轻钱包在区块链商业中扮演着极其重要的角色,市场需求不断增长,开发者需关注技术要求、安全性及用户体验等关键要素。通过深入分析成功案例与竞争对手,制定清晰的市场定位,新兴的轻钱包项目有机会取得重大的商业成功。同时,用户在使用轻钱包的过程中,需确保自身的数字资产安全,为加密货币的普及与发展贡献一份力量。